Well I bought, the red headed stranger arc and the black cat arc. I'm out. This was Marvel's one time to "try to explain" everything, but didn't do anything at all. Seriousl the RHS arc, was suppose to fill in gaps with MJ, but it just focused on Chameleon and "explained" what MJ has been up to in one freaking page. The Black Cat arc, just a chance for the writers to relive their single glory days as Spidey and to get in bed with BC. I'm out, the stories are pointess and now it looks like they are going to ruin Ben Reily's good character as well...
